Courthouse, Prescott, Arizona





The moving All Veterans Memorial, on the west side of Courthouse Plaza,
is the fourth of the five bronzes, having been dedicated in 1989. This inspiring
tribute to the U.S. Armed Forces was created by native artist Neil Logan as
a memorial to Yavapai County veterans who gave their lives in World War I,
World War II, Korea and Vietnam. The two soldiers depicted are in Vietnam
where one is signaling for a medical helicopter to land and rescue a wounded
man. Artist Logan attended Northern Arizona University in Flagstaff after
having served in Vietnam for 27 months.
